I made my card today using TCM's Fruity for You and Summertime with Fibi and Lilly stamp sets.  

I stamped the glass of lemonade image in black stazon ink on some vellum cardstock.  Then, using my Stampin Up dye based markers, I colored the image on the backside of the vellum, since the ink will smear a bit with the stazon ink.  I did a bit of 'fussy cutting' around the images, adhered them with some EK success liquid glue pen, and finished it off with some diamond stickles on the ice cubes.


The honeydew twine from The Twinery was a great subtle embellishment to the card since it matched the patterned polka paper so well.  The cloud embossing folder is from Stampin Up.  The pitcher and spoon are from NinaB Designs for Spellbinders called Homespun.
